What Does a Boat Insurance Agent in Niles Cost?
Boat insurance costs in Illinois vary widely based on boat value, size, horsepower, and usage. Typical annual premiums range from 300 to 800 dollars for a standard runabout or fishing boat. Larger yachts or high performance vessels can cost 1,000 to 3,000 dollars or more per year. This is general information, not insurance advice.

Do I need boat insurance in Illinois?
Illinois does not mandate boat insurance for all boats, but you must have liability coverage if you finance your boat or keep it at a marina. Many agents recommend it to protect against accidents and property damage.
What does boat insurance cover in Illinois?
Boat insurance in Illinois typically covers liability for bodily injury and property damage, physical damage to your boat, and medical payments. Some policies include coverage for towing, wreck removal, and uninsured boaters.
